Newark Airport Air Traffic Control: Improvement Project Faces Significant Delays
Newark Liberty International Airport (EWR), a major East Coast hub, is experiencing ongoing challenges with its air traffic control system. A crucial modernization project aimed at improving efficiency and reducing delays is significantly behind schedule, raising concerns about potential disruptions to air travel. This delay impacts not only passengers but also the wider aviation industry, highlighting the complexities of upgrading aging infrastructure.
Project Delays and Their Impact
The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) initiated the ambitious air traffic control modernization project at EWR several years ago. Reasons Behind the Setbacks
Several factors contribute to the project's setbacks. These include:
- Supply chain issues: The global supply chain crisis has impacted the timely delivery of essential components needed for the upgrade.
- Unexpected technical challenges: The complexity of integrating new technology into an existing system has presented unforeseen technical difficulties.
- Workforce shortages: A shortage of skilled technicians and engineers has slowed down the installation and testing phases of the project.
- Regulatory hurdles: Navigating the necessary regulatory approvals has also added to the project's timeline.
FAA Response and Future Outlook
The FAA has acknowledged the delays and is working to expedite the project's completion. They are exploring strategies to mitigate the impact on air travel, including:
- Increased staffing: The FAA is actively recruiting and training additional air traffic controllers to manage the current workload.
- Optimized scheduling: Air traffic controllers are implementing optimized scheduling techniques to improve efficiency and minimize delays.
- Improved communication: Enhanced communication with airlines and passengers is crucial to managing expectations and minimizing disruptions.
While the FAA remains committed to completing the modernization project, the exact timeline remains unclear. Passengers traveling through Newark Airport should anticipate potential delays and check their flight status regularly. Airlines are also advising passengers to allow extra time for travel and to be prepared for possible disruptions.
